2017 Winter Universiade. Semi-final. Russia - Canada

07.02.2017

Today on the 7th of February, the Russian student national team will compete in the 2017 Winter Universiade semi-final against Canada.

Russia have been unstoppable at this tournament so far, brushing aside South Korea 14:0, Latvia 7:1 and Japan 14:0 and 9:2. The latter triumpg against the Japanese came in the quarter-final stage, with our players recovering from a second period blip to calmly ease in the next stage. Andrei Alexeev is the team's top scorer at the moment with twelve points (5+7).

Despite those comfortable victories, Canada will offer a much sterner challenge today. They are also perfect in the competition, seeing off the USA 6:0, Great Britain 14:0 and Slovakia 5:3. In the quarter-finals, they beat Latvia 5:2.

Puck drop is scheduled for 13:00 Moscow time. A live Match TV broadcast can be watched right here:
